Camshaft drive: Timing chainTiming belt
Engine chain usually needs to be replaced less often than the timing belt, but the cost of replacing the chain is usually higher. Chain motors are considered to be more reliable, but noisier and more vibration generating.

Performance

Power: 105 HP130 HP
Torque: 145 NM230 NM
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: 10 seconds8.7 seconds
Peugeot 208 is a more dynamic driving.
Fiat 500 engine produces 25 HP less power than Peugeot 208, whereas torque is 85 NM less than Peugeot 208. Due to the lower power, Fiat 500 reaches 100 km/h speed 1.3 seconds later.

Fuel consumption

Fuel consumption (l/100km): 4.24.5
Real fuel consumption: 6.3 l/100km6.8 l/100km
The Fiat 500 is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y.
By specification Fiat 500 consumes 0.3 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Peugeot 208, which means that by driving the Fiat 500 over 15,000 km in a year you can save 45 litres of fuel.
By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Fiat 500 consumes 0.5 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Peugeot 208.

Engines

Average engine lifespan: 250'000 km350'000 km
Engine resource depends largely on regular maintenance and the quality of the oils and fuels used, but under equal conditions the average life of a Peugeot 208 engine could be longer.
Engine production duration: 12 years10 years
Engine spread: Used also on Alfa Romeo MiToInstalled on at least 16 other car models, including Opel Corsa, Peugeot 308, Opel Combo, Peugeot 3008, Citroen C4
In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. Peugeot 208 might be a better choice in this respect.
